This report presents a noise survey performed in the immediate vicinity of the proposed
AT &T telecommunications facility at 11247 Morris Road SE in Yelm, Washington. This noise
survey extends from the proposed equipment to the nearest properties. The purpose of this
report is to document the existing conditions and the impacts of the acoustical changes due
to the proposed equipment. This report contains data on the existing and predicted noise
environments, impact criteria and an evaluation of the predicted sound levels as they relate
to the criteria.
Ambient Conditions
Existing ambient noise levels were measured on site with a Larson -Davis 820 sound level
meter on September 16, 2009. Measurements were conducted as close to the proposed
location as possible and the property lines in accordance with the State of Washington code
for Maximum Environmental Noise Levels WAC 173 -60 -020. The average ambient noise
level was 41 dBA, due primarily to a light breeze. The weather during the measurements
was overcast with no precipitation.
Code Requirements
The site is located within the Thurston County Zoning jurisdiction. The site is on Rural
Residential property. The nearest receiving property is also Rural Residential.
The proposed new equipment consists of equipment support cabinets, which are expected to
run 24 hours a day.
Thurston County Code Chapter 21.57.030 incorporates Washington Administrative Code
Chapter 173 -60 in its entirety by reference, and further designates all residences as Class A
EDNA. Under WAC 173 -60, noise from equipment on a Class A EDNA (Residential)
property is limited as follows:

Class A EDNA Receiver: Noise is limited to 55 dBA during daytime hours. During nighttime
hours, between the hours of 10 p.m. and 7 a.m., the maximum permissible sound level is
decreased by 10 decibels. Since the support cabinets are expected to operate 24 hours a
day, they must meet the 45 dBA nighttime limit.
Predicted Equipment Sound Levels
The proposed equipment includes one AT &T Wireless UMTS Cabinet and three Argus TE -40
Cabinets. According to manufacturer data, the AT &T Wireless UMTS iBTS Outdoor Cabinet
has a sound pressure levels of 58 dBA at 3 feet and the Argus TE -40 Outdoor Battery
Enclosure produce a sound pressure level of 64 dBA at 3 feet. The total sound pressure
level from all four cabinets is 69 dBA at a distance of 3 feet.
To predict equipment noise levels at the receiving properties, this survey used the methods
established by ARI Standard 275 -97. Application factors such as location, height, and
reflective surfaces are accounted for in predicting the sound level at the nearest receivers.
The equipment cabinets are to be located on a concrete equipment pad within an existing
equipment compound. The nearest receiving property is approximately 240 feet west of the
equipment location. The predicted sound level at the nearest property is shown in Table 1
below.

As shown in Table 1, the combined sound pressure level from the proposed equipment
cabinets at the nearest receiving property is predicted to be 31 dBA. This complies with the
45 dBA night -time noise limit to a residential property. Since the equipment noise will be
loudest at the nearest receiving property line, we predict that the noise levels will not exceed
code limits at all other receiving property lines.
